&lt;div&gt;Hmmm.  The animation just added agrees with another animation I've seen, in that the three innermost moons never line up all on one side of Jupiter at the same time.  So if &amp;quot;Hi&amp;quot; (Io) and &amp;quot;What's your name&amp;quot; (Europa) conjoin on the right side as we're looking, then &amp;quot;What's your name&amp;quot; and &amp;quot;MOOOON!&amp;quot; (Ganymede) should conjoin on the left side.
